    Seven-time World Champion Michael Schumacher will return to Formula One with Mercedes GP next season.

    The F1 legend has signed a three-year deal to drive for the German manufacturer in 2010, with the contract said to be initially worth around £6.2million.

    Schumacher, who turns 41 on January 3rd and who will therefore easily be the oldest driver on the grid, will partner fellow German Nico Rosberg.
